P&G Groß-Gerau is a state-of-the-art production technology site, which manufactures a variety of Oral-B and WICK/Vicks brands.

We are now looking for an Intelligent Controls & Automation (ICA)Engineer to be part of the innovative Health Care team at the Groß-Gerau plant.

YOUR ROLE AS Intelligent Controls & Automation Engineer (m/f/d)

At P&G, our Engineers are responsible for inventing, developing, reapplying, and delivering breakthrough technologies that provide winning products for consumers in Europe and around the world.

Use your drive and ingenuity! From Day 1, you are the manager of your technology and will put your ideas into practice. You have the technical curiosity and knowledge to develop innovative approaches to big challenges. You will lead and execute end to end technology development within a global team of professionals. You will be responsible for engineering projects where you can rely on your automation, IT/OT and electrical aligned knowledge. You drive the digitization to the next level and develop solutions for existing production machines / automation processes. You are responsible for developing and qualifying production equipment and own the tracking and reporting against project technical success criteria. You engage with machine suppliers and internal stakeholders from all functions (e.g., Product R&D, Manufacturing, Supply Network) to design and deliver an innovation pipeline including production technologies to delight our consumers with superior products at the right quality and cost. Your work will require creativity, innovation, teamwork, and leadership.

Job Qualifications

YOUR PROFILE

  • You have, or will have completed before starting with us, a master’s degree in electrical engineering with strong academic results.

  • You demonstrate excellent analytical and problem-solving skills, a drive for leadership, and a strong passion for technology.

  • You have Technical Mastery – base experiences with PLC programming and IT/OT environments.

  • You excelled in Design & Innovation management – demonstrating the ability to manage design priorities, understand design problems and translate them into design intentions. Leading to effective and efficient management of design resources, as well as cost effective functional solutions.

  • You work effectively with entrepreneurial thinking, agility, and a strong sense of ownership with diverse groups of people by embracing creativity, innovation, and initiative.

  • You are skilled to make complex decisions using all the data available but confident to use your gut feeling and instinct.

  • Preferably, you already have experiences with Project management, High-level programming languages, Databases (e.g. MS SQL). Manufacturing Execution Systems (MES), SAP, Sensory/ image processing, and Machine safetyClean design.

  • You can communicate proficiently in English (written and spoken).

  • Short work experience, internships and studies abroad are considered as a plus.
